243. Re: STARTING OFF
Most use a combination of white vinegar & baking soda with water. Some also add lemon. There are pre-made ones at the health stores. It's best to soak produce in the solution for a bit, if you can, and to also have a veggie scrub brush.

Yogurt (4 cups):
1 cup un-hulled Sesame Seeds, grounded (optional soaked)
1 Lemon, peeled
1 Tbs Agave or 2 Dates
Pinch Salt
3 cups Water
Blend.
Mayonnaise:
½ cup Almonds, soaked
1/4 cup Water
½ Lemon, juiced
1 small Garlic clove
½ tsp salt
Add in a steady stream, until emulsified:
1 ½ cup Olive Oil
Blend until smooth.

Sweet Potato Soup
Sweet Potatoes peeled & chopped (blend 1st)
½-1 Apple peeled & chopped
1-2 Garlic cloves
1-2 cups Water
Blend. Add a dash of Sea Salt & Cinnamon on top.

WendySmiling, here's a yummy Tomato soup recipe you may like:
Tomatoes (blend or chop 1st)
Sundried Tomatoes (1-2 per tomato)
1-2 Garlic cloves
Optional: Cayenne or Cumin Powder, Sea Salt
Blend. If want less thick, add water.

257. Re: Yucky Spirulina
Spirulina works much better in savory recipes rather than sweet, such as a soup or a dip. Even just mixing it with avocado is tasty.
Here's some ideas:
Spirulina Guacamole Dip
3 Tbs Spirulina
2 Avocados
Tomato
1 cup Cilantro
Garlic clove
Onion
Jalapeno
Lime and/or Lemon, juice
Dash Salt
Blend all but stir in tomatoes.
